Mysql Alter Nedir? Ne İşe Yarar? Ne İçin Kullanılır?

MySQL ALTER komutu, mevcut bir veritabanı, tablo veya sütun yapısını değiştirmek için kullanılan bir SQL komutudur. Veritabanı yöneticileri veya geliştiriciler, veritabanı gereksinimleri değiştikçe tabloları veya sütunları düzenlemek veya güncellemek için ALTER komutunu kullanır.


Mysql Alter Nedir? Ne İşe Yarar? Ne İçin Kullanılır?

MySQL ALTER, MySQL veritabanı yönetim sisteminin bir parçası olan SQL dilinde kullanılan bir komuttur. ALTER komutu, mevcut bir veritabanı, tablo veya sütun yapısını değiştirmek veya düzenlemek için kullanılır. Bu komut, veritabanı yöneticilerine veya geliştiricilere mevcut veritabanı yapısında yapılan değişiklikleri uygulamak ve yönetmek için bir yol sunar.

Ne İşe Yarar?

ALTER komutu, veritabanı yöneticilerinin veya geliştiricilerin mevcut veritabanı yapısını esnek bir şekilde değiştirmelerine olanak tanır. Bu komut sayesinde, veritabanında yapılan değişiklikler, mevcut verilerin kaybına neden olmadan uygulanabilir. Dolayısıyla, veritabanı yapısında değişiklikler yapmak veya sütunları eklemek, kaldırmak veya değiştirmek gibi işlemler yapmak mümkündür.

Bazı örneklerde, aşağıdaki gibi ALTER komutu kullanılabilir:

  • Tabloya yeni bir sütun eklemek veya mevcut bir sütunu kaldırmak
  • Tablonun adını veya şemasını değiştirmek
  • Sütunun veri tipini veya boyutunu değiştirmek
  • Tabloya birincil anahtar veya dış anahtar eklemek veya kaldırmak

Ne İçin Kullanılır?

ALTER komutu, veritabanı yöneticilerinin veya geliştiricilerin bir veritabanı yapısını güncellemek ve değiştirmek için kullanılır. Bu komut, veritabanı geliştirme sürecinde veya veritabanı yapılarında değişiklik yapılması gerektiğinde çok işe yarar.

Örneğin, bir e-ticaret web sitesi için kullanılan bir MySQL veritabanında, yeni bir özellik eklemek veya mevcut bir özelliği güncellemek isteyebilirsiniz. Bu durumda ALTER komutunu kullanarak veritabanı tablolarını veya sütunları düzenleyebilirsiniz. Böylece, müşterilere yeni bir özellik sunabilir veya mevcut bir özelliği iyileştirebilirsiniz.

Ayrıca, bir projenin gereksinimleri değiştikçe ve büyüdükçe, veritabanı yapısını değiştirmek veya düzenlemek gerekebilir. ALTER komutu bu tür durumlarda büyük bir kolaylık sağlar. Bu komut sayesinde mevcut veritabanı yapısını güncelleyebilir ve projenin büyüme veya değişikliklere uyum sağlamasını sağlayabilirsiniz.

Sonuç olarak,

MySQL ALTER komutu, mevcut bir veritabanı, tablo veya sütun yapısını değiştirmek veya düzenlemek için kullanılan önemli bir SQL komutudur. Bu komut, veritabanı yöneticilerine veya geliştiricilere mevcut veritabanı yapılarında yapılan değişiklikleri uygulamak ve yönetmek için esnek bir yöntem sunar. ALTER komutunu kullanarak, veritabanı yapısında değişiklikler yapabilir, özellikleri ekleyebilir veya güncelleyebilir ve projelerinizin gereksinimlerine göre veritabanınızı kolayca uyarlayabilirsiniz.


Sıkça Sorulan Sorular

Mysql Alter Nedir?

Mysql Alter, mevcut bir veritabanı tablosunun, sütunlarının veya veritabanının yapısını değiştirmek veya güncellemek için kullanılan bir SQL komutudur.

Ne İşe Yarar?

Alter komutu sayesinde mevcut bir veritabanı tablosunun yapısını değiştirebilir, yeni sütunlar ekleyebilir, sütunların tiplerini veya boyutlarını değiştirebilir, sütunları silebilir veya yeniden adlandırabilirsiniz.

Ne İçin Kullanılır?

Alter komutu, mevcut bir veritabanı yapısını güncellemek veya değiştirmek istediğiniz durumlarda kullanılır. Örneğin, bir tabloya yeni bir sütun eklemek, bir sütunun veri tipini değiştirmek veya tablo adını değiştirmek gibi durumlarda kullanılabilir.

Alter komutu nasıl kullanılır?

Alter komutu, aşağıdaki formatta kullanılır:

ALTER TABLE table_name ALTER COLUMN column_name data_type;

Bu komutla tablo ismi, değiştirilecek sütunun ismi ve sütunun yeni veri tipi belirtilir. Başka değişiklikler yapmak için komutun farklı formatlarını kullanabilirsiniz.

Alter komutu hangi durumlarda hata verebilir?

Alter komutu çalıştırılırken bazı durumlarda hata verebilir. Örneğin, eğer tabloda mevcut olan bir sütunu silmeye çalışırsanız "Unknown column" hatası alırsınız. Aynı şekilde, tablo adı yanlış yazılırsa veya tablo mevcut değilse "Table doesn't exist" hatası alırsınız. Bu nedenle, komutu kullanmadan önce dikkatli olmak önemlidir.

Diğer Ne İşe Yarar Yazıları
Ne İşe Yarar